买专利,只认龙图腾
首页 专利交易 科技果 科技人才 科技服务 商标交易 会员权益 IP管家助手 需求市场 关于龙图腾
 /  免费注册
到顶部 到底部
清空 搜索

【发明授权】一种非公网通信的单灯控制器批量远程升级软件的方法_南京理控物联技术有限公司_201910471608.5 

申请/专利权人:南京理控物联技术有限公司

申请日:2019-05-31

公开(公告)日:2024-04-02

公开(公告)号:CN112015442B

主分类号:G06F8/65

分类号:G06F8/65

优先权:

专利状态码:有效-授权

法律状态:2024.04.02#授权;2020.12.18#实质审查的生效;2020.12.01#公开

摘要:一种适用于非公网通信的单灯控制器批量远程升级软件的方法,涉及室外照明的单灯控制器技术领域,尤其涉及采用载波、ZigBee或LoRa等非公网通信的单灯控制器。在本发明中,升级服务器获得升级文件,发出升级指令,照明集控器单灯集中器将升级指令转发至单灯控制器,并转发单灯控制器应答帧至升级服务器。升级服务器按顺序广播发送m个升级包,然后查询第一个单灯控制器的升级状态,判断是否需要补发升级包?若为是,则按顺序广播补发升级包,并对升级结果再次判断;若为否,则查询下一个单灯控制器,直至全部单灯控制器都接收到完整的升级包,批量软件升级成功。本发明提高了采用载波、ZigBee或LoRa等非公网通信的单灯控制器批量远程升级软件的效率,大大缩短了升级时间,减轻了运维人员的工作量。

主权项:1.一种非公网通信的单灯控制器批量远程升级软件的方法,其特征在于包括如下步骤:1升级服务器获得升级文件,发出升级指令;照明集控器将升级指令转发至单灯控制器,并将单灯控制器的应答帧转发至升级服务器;2升级服务器按顺序广播发送m个升级包;3查询第一个单灯控制器的升级状态,判断是否需要补发升级包,若为是,则按顺序广播发送未收到的升级包,并对升级结果再次判断;若为否,则查询下一个单灯控制器,直至全部单灯控制器都接收到完整的升级包;4批量升级软件成功,结束;具体的:升级服务器对照明集控器所管辖的全部单灯控制器进行广播发送升级包,所有的单灯控制器都能收到升级服务器发来的升级包;当所有的升级包发送完成后,升级服务器逐一查询每个单灯控制器的升级状态,通过返回的升级状态,判断是否需要补发升级包,若需要补发,则补发第1个单灯控制器未收到的升级包;若不需要补发,则表示该单灯控制器升级成功,继续查询下个单灯控制器的升级状态,直到所有单灯控制器全部升级成功;单灯控制器返回的升级状态中包含单灯控制器当前的软件版本、升级位图信息,当前的软件版本表示是否升级成功,升级位图反映单灯控制器未收到的升级包序号;升级服务器通过单灯控制器返回的升级状态,综合判断该单灯控制器是否升级成功,或需要补发哪些升级包;升级服务器查询单灯控制器的升级状态采用点对点通信,一问一答的通信方式;而发送升级包采用广播通信方式;升级文件中包含CRC16校验码,为确保升级文件无误,单灯控制器收到所有升级包后,会对升级文件进行CRC16校验,若校验码一致,则将升级文件搬运到实际的应用区,实现程序升级;若校验码不一致,则重新升级。

全文数据:

权利要求:

百度查询: 南京理控物联技术有限公司 一种非公网通信的单灯控制器批量远程升级软件的方法

免责声明
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。